Linux RedHat NFS服务器配置与ARM系统挂载教程

需积分: 36 4 下载量 155 浏览量 更新于2024-09-10 收藏 484KB PDF 举报
本文档主要介绍了如何在Linux Red Hat 9.0系统上配置NFS(Network File System)服务器,并在基于arm TX2440A的开发板上挂载NFS,实现跨设备的文件共享。配置过程包括了在服务器端设置NFS服务,以及在客户端(开发板)上挂载NFS共享目录。同时,文中还提供了针对常见错误的解决方法。 1. NFS服务器配置 在Linux Red Hat 9.0环境下,配置NFS服务器的步骤如下: - 打开服务器设置,选择NFS服务器,点击增加,设定共享目录(如根目录/)和访问IP(可设为*或具体IP),设置权限为读/写。 - 使用`setup`命令进入系统服务设置,勾选NFS和SMB服务,确保系统启动时自动运行这两个服务。 - 通过`service nfs restart`命令重启NFS服务,以确保服务生效。 2. 挂载NFS - 在ARM开发板上,首先确保与服务器通过网线连接,并设置相同网段的IP地址。 - 使用`mount -t nfs`命令挂载NFS,例如:`mount -t nfs 192.168.1.230:/ /mnt/nfs`,其中192.168.1.230是服务器IP,/是服务器共享的目录,/mnt/nfs是开发板本地的挂载点。 - 挂载成功后,通过`/mnt/nfs`即可访问服务器的共享内容。要卸载NFS,使用`umount /mnt/nfs`命令。 3. 常见错误及解决办法 - 错误:`mount: RPC: Unable to receive; errno=Connection refused` 解决方案:确保NFS服务已启动,使用`service nfs restart`重启服务。如果问题依然存在,可能需要启动portmap服务,使用`service portmap start`命令。 总结来说,配置NFS服务器并挂载NFS共享是实现Linux系统之间高效文件共享的重要方式。通过正确配置服务器端和客户端,可以轻松地在不同设备之间交换和操作文件。注意检查网络连接、服务状态以及端口映射服务,这些都是解决问题的关键。